About The Company:
The Ventura County Sheriff's Department is the largest law enforcement agency in the County of Ventura. The department employs over 1,200 personnel and offers a variety of law enforcement career opportunities. All personnel are provided with continuous opportunities to expand their education and law enforcement expertise.
Ventura is located on the California coast an hour north of Downtown Los Angeles and 30 minutes south of Santa Barbara. Our county offers natural beauty of both coastal and mountainous terrain. With mild climates and diverse recreational opportunities, the County of Ventura offers safe neighborhoods, excellent schools and family oriented communities that make for a satisfying lifestyle.
Job Titles and Descriptions:
The Ventura County Sheriff’s Department is comprised of men and women who have dedicated their lives to serving their community by protecting life and property. The department would like to expand its law enforcement family by hiring motivated, qualified individuals for the position of Deputy Sheriff Trainee. Each candidate should have good moral character and process good judgment as well as exhibit trustworthiness, courage, teamwork, and compassion.
The Ventura County Sheriff’s Department can offer you an exciting, rewarding career with the potential to experience a variety of assignments and work in various locations. These assignments include but are not limited to: SWAT, hostage negotiator, bomb squad, K-9 unit, air unit, narcotics, detectives and more. Once you have completed the 22-week California POST Certified Academy, you will promote to Deputy Sheriff. The starting salary for a Deputy Sheriff is $61,400 - $84,600 with full benefits.
